In a recent statement,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ov highlighted a controversial development regarding the future of the Nord Stream gas pipeline. He revealed that the United States is reportedly interested in acquiring the European segment of this vital gas delivery system. This revelation has ignited discussions about the implications for Europe's energy security and the broader geopolitical landscape.
The Context of the Nord Stream Pipeline
The Nord Stream pipeline, which transports natural gas from Russia to Europe, has been a focal point in international energy politics for years. With the ongoing tensions between Russia and the West, particularly following recent geopolitical conflicts, the pipeline has become even more significant. Its strategic importance to European energy supplies makes any potential changes to its ownership or operational control a matter of concern.
What the US Proposal Entails
According to Lavrov, US officials have indicated their interest in purchasing the European operations of the Nord Stream. The intention, as reported, is to refurbish the pipeline and exert control over gas shipments to European markets. This move raises questions about the motivations behind it and the potential repercussions for both Europe and Russia.
Impacts on European Energy Security
The prospect of US control over the Nord Stream’s European sector could have far-reaching consequences for European energy security. With Europe heavily reliant on Russian natural gas, a shift in control may disrupt existing supply chains. Here are several key impacts to consider:
- Increased Prices: US control could lead to higher gas prices for European consumers as market dynamics change.
- Supply Reliability: The introduction of a new operator may bring uncertainties regarding the reliability of gas supplies.
- Geopolitical Tensions: This move could exacerbate tensions between Russia and the US, potentially leading to retaliatory measures.
The Geopolitical Landscape Shifts
The US interest in the Nord Stream pipeline isn't just about energy; it's tied to broader geopolitical strategies. As Europe aims to diversify its energy sources away from Russian dependency, US involvement could be seen as a step towards asserting more influence in the region. This dynamic could lead to:
- Stronger US-EU Relations: Closer alliances may form as Europe seeks reliable alternatives to Russian gas.
- A Shift in Market Control: The US entry into the European gas market could alter competitive landscapes, impacting prices and availability.
- Increased Investments: If the US succeeds in taking control, it may spur further investments in European infrastructure.
